Sherlock Holmes, in his in- vestigating of the disappearover of Silver Blaze_lavourite or the Wesser Cup, from its lint- moor stables at King's Pyal, and the murder of the hors trainer, John Straker, has interviewed, Silns Brow trainer at Capleton stabies,a 'neighbouring rival racing es- tablishment. They appear to have had a stromy interview,
Tracks of Silver Blaze and an accompanying man have been found leading to Capleton stable. This fact is not known to Colonel Ross, the owner of the horse, 7407* to Inspector Gregory, of Scotland Yard, wohn is the official investigator of the Fitzroy Simpson, a racing man, has been under auspicion..
crime.
